Part Overview
The CALVC164245IGQLREP is a voltage level translator IC manufactured by Texas Instruments, designed for bidirectional signal translation between different voltage domains. This device features 2 circuits with 8 channels per circuit in a 56-VFBGA package, supporting VCCA voltage range of 2.3 V to 3.6 V and VCCB voltage range of 3 V to 5.5 V. Substitute Part Grouping Explanation
Substitute parts for the CALVC164245IGQLREP are identified based on strict equivalence of core functional parameters: translator type (voltage level), channel configuration (bidirectional, 2 circuits, 8 channels per circuit), output type (tri-state, non-inverted), and operating temperature range (-40°C to 85°C).
The substitute parts 74FCT164245TPAG and 74FCT164245TPAG8 maintain functional equivalence through identical circuit topology and channel architecture. Both substitutes are manufactured by Renesas Electronics Corporation and belong to the 74FCT series, which provides compatible voltage translation functionality.
Key parameters determining substitution validity:
- Bidirectional channel configuration with 2 circuits and 8 channels per circuit
- Tri-state, non-inverted output type
- Operating temperature range of -40°C to 85°C
- ROHS3 compliance and MSL 1 rating
- Surface mount technology
The primary distinction between the main part and substitutes is the package format (56-VFBGA versus 48-TSSOP) and voltage specifications, which require design-level evaluation for specific applications.

Engineering Selection Recommendations
The 74FCT164245TPAG and 74FCT164245TPAG8 are functionally equivalent substitutes for the discontinued CALVC164245IGQLREP based on matching circuit topology, channel configuration, and output characteristics. Both substitute parts maintain active product status with Renesas Electronics Corporation, ensuring long-term availability and supply chain stability.
The primary consideration for component selection is the package format transition from 56-VFBGA to 48-TSSOP, which requires PCB layout redesign and may impact thermal management characteristics. The voltage specification differences (VCCA minimum of 2.7 V versus 2.3 V, and VCCB minimum of 4.5 V versus 3 V) must be evaluated against specific application requirements to confirm compatibility.

Frequently Asked Questions (FAQ)
Q: Are the 74FCT164245TPAG and 74FCT164245TPAG8 truly equivalent to the CALVC164245IGQLREP?
A: Both parts provide functional equivalence in voltage level translation with identical circuit topology (2 circuits, 8 channels per circuit), bidirectional operation, and tri-state non-inverted output. The primary differences are package format (48-TSSOP versus 56-VFBGA) and voltage operating ranges, which require application-specific validation.
Q: What is the difference between 74FCT164245TPAG and 74FCT164245TPAG8?
A: Both parts are electrically identical. The difference lies in packaging format: 74FCT164245TPAG is supplied in tube packaging, while 74FCT164245TPAG8 is supplied in cut tape and Digi-Reel formats. Selection depends on procurement volume and handling requirements.
Q: Can I use these substitutes without PCB redesign?
A: No. The package format change from 56-VFBGA to 48-TSSOP requires PCB layout modification, including footprint redesign and potential signal routing adjustments. Thermal management characteristics may also differ between packages.
Q: Are the voltage specifications compatible with my application?
A: The substitute parts specify VCCA minimum of 2.7 V (versus 2.3 V for the original) and VCCB minimum of 4.5 V (versus 3 V for the original). Applications operating at the lower voltage boundaries of the original part may require circuit redesign or alternative component selection.
